What is one benefit of enrolling in a Medicare Advantage plan?

Enrolling in a Medicare Advantage plan provides the advantage of potentially lower coverage costs compared to traditional Medicare. Medicare Advantage plans often include additional benefits beyond what traditional Medicare offers, such as vision, dental, and hearing services, all while presenting these benefits at a cost that can be more manageable for beneficiaries. For many, the out-of-pocket expenses can be lower due to the structured cost-sharing setups these plans offer, including copayments, coinsurance, and an out-of-pocket maximum, which traditional Medicare does not impose. This financial benefit can make Medicare Advantage plans an appealing option for those seeking comprehensive coverage while managing their healthcare expenses effectively.

In comparison to the other options, unlimited access to any healthcare provider is typically not true for Medicare Advantage plans, as they often have specific networks. Coverage for all medications without limitations is not accurate, since medications may still require prior authorization or adhere to specific formularies. Lastly, the requirement to have a primary care provider is common with many Medicare Advantage plans, as they emphasize care coordination and utilization management.
